This page was exported from IT certification exam materials [ http://blog.dumpleader.com ] Export date:Sat Jan 18 12:54:26 2025 / +0000 GMT ___________________________________________________ Title: [Q35-Q58] Real Exam Questions C_FIORDEV_21 Dumps Exam Questions in here [Sep-2022] --------------------------------------------------- Real Exam Questions C_FIORDEV_21 Dumps Exam Questions in here [Sep-2022] Get Latest Sep-2022 Conduct effective penetration tests using C_FIORDEV_21 Q35. Does QUnit support SAPUI5 view tests?  No, for UI tests you must use OPA5.  Yes, you can implement a test class to test UI aspects of SAPUI5.  You can use the QUnit-extensions, called Selenium, to test SAPUI5 controls. Q36. What are Smart Controls?  SAPUI5 controls that can be rendered dynamically according to OData service annotations  Basic SAPUI5 controls recommended for standalone usage  The predecessor of Smart Templates  Application templates for SAPUI5 applications to optimize development Q37. In the screenshot, which element of the Arrange-Act-Assert pattern corresponds to the Act in a QUnittest?  this.calculator.press(“1”)  teardown : function() {}  QUnit.module  QUnit.test Q38. To what namespace is the ExtensionPoint class assigned?  sap.ui.core.extension  sap.ui.extension  sap.ui.core  sap.m Q39. Which of the following are the main states of a file in GIT?  Modified  Committed  Changed  Released Q40. What is the relation between the model and the controller in the standard MVC implementation?  The model notifies the controller about changes.  The controller sets the model visibility.  The model updates the controller.  The controller modifies the model. Q41. What class in the SAPUI5 API supports back-end mock up and is recommended by SAP?  sap.ui.core.MockServer  sap.ui.app.MockServer  sap.m.MockServer  sap.ui.core.util.MockServer Q42. What is the result of a GIT Revert?  Undoes a committed snapshot.  Reverts back to the previous state of the project.  Removes all untracked files from the working directory. Q43. Which SAP Fiori personalization elements holds all of the technical information needed to start an app?  User Preferences  Tile  Group  Catalog Q44. SAP Fiori Elements utilizes a metadata-driven approach for SAP Fiori app development. What are the implications of this?  App developers must use JavaScript to allow their applications to read OData annotations and metadata  The SAPUI5 runtime interprets metadata and annotations of the OData service and uses the corresponding views for the Fiori app at startup  Smart Templates must be used by the developer to consume OData annotations and metadata so the SAPUI5 runtime can use the corresponding view  SAPUI5 Smart Controls must be created by developers to utilize the Data annotations and metadata of SAP Fiori Elements templates Q45. You develop an SAPU15 app and implement a FacetFilter. What events are triggered when the user interacts with the FacetFilter control? (2 answers)  oninit  confirm  reset  listFilter Q46. What result do you expect from the de-composition and re-composition phases? (3 answers)  The prevention of irrelevant data being shown to the user  A purpose-built app to support personas  A responsive de-composed design  The break-down of a large transaction  An adaptive and coherent app Q47. You are developing a complex screen and you use fragments. What features of fragments are useful here?Note: There are 2 correct answers to this question  Fragments can be a stand-alone view  Fragments are light-weight Ul parts that can be reused.  Fragments can be found by the SAPUI5 runtime libraries.  Fragments have their own controller Q48. What is the required content of the Components file of an extension project? (2 answers)  The controller IDs  The namespace of the parent app  The link to the parent app  The customizing section Q49. When is the use of a master-detail pattern not recommended?  You need to offer complex filters for the master list of items.  When you want to display different facets of the same object, data, or both.  You want to display a single object. Q50. Which of the following annotations would you use for a List Report Page? Note: There are 2 correct answers to this question.  Use Search.defaultSearchElement annotation to define input fields with value help  Use @Ul.selectionField annotation to define a fuzzy search field  Use @UI.Iineitem importance annotation to determine in which devices the field is displayed  Use @UI hidden annotation to hide the fields that are not to be displayed on a list report Q51. What type of concurrency control is offered by OData?  Optimistic concurrency control  No concurrency control  Exclusive concurrency control  Pessimistic concurrency control Q52. What parameter is needed when instantiating a MockServer object?  url  uri  rootUrl  rootUri Q53. You need the server to sort and filter the data used in your customers app. Which SAPUI5-supported data model must you use?  ODataModel  JSONModel  ResourceModel  XMLModel Q54. What is the purpose of the Logon Plugin Data Vault of the SAP Fiori Client?  Prevent the access to all nonessential plugins  Provide a reusable component for storing sensitive information on the device  Allow a client policy that can be defined on the mobility platform  Enable secure and seamless handling of attachments Q55. What aspects of the runtime environment can be accessed by the Device API of SAPUI5?  Language  Screen size  Touch-specific features  Operating system  Orientation change Q56. Why do you use the Cordova and SAP Kapsel plug-ins when using the SAP Web IDE, SAP HAT add-on? (2 answers)  To use X.509 client certificates  To integrate device APIs  To enable multiple SAPUI5 apps  To use offline OData Q57. In the data in the screenshot, you want to display the List of Companies in the Americas region which binding option do you use for the X Y and Z values in the view?  X: /regions/u/companies Y companies/u/name L companies/u/city  X: /regions/companies Y companies/name Z companies/city  X: /regions/companies Y: name Z:.city  X: /regions/O/companies Y: name Z: city Q58. While testing an SAP Fiori app you discover that a button on the page delivers no response. Which of the following agile pyramid options do you use?  Sinon  OPA  Mock server  QUnit  Loading … Authentic Best resources for C_FIORDEV_21 Online Practice Exam: https://www.dumpleader.com/C_FIORDEV_21_exam.html --------------------------------------------------- Images: https://blog.dumpleader.com/wp-content/plugins/watu/loading.gif https://blog.dumpleader.com/wp-content/plugins/watu/loading.gif --------------------------------------------------- --------------------------------------------------- Post date: 2022-09-01 16:18:46 Post date GMT: 2022-09-01 16:18:46 Post modified date: 2022-09-01 16:18:46 Post modified date GMT: 2022-09-01 16:18:46